STUDY ON SEISMIC PERFORMANCE OF REINFORCED CONCRETE FRAME
The study addresses the issue of seismic design method for reinforced concrete structures in current Chinese codes by comparing with the present internationally advanced performance-based seismic design method. Based on a great number of the domestic and foreign literatures, the paper carries on the refinement to Chinas seismic level and the performance level. The seismic level of building structures is divided into four levels here. Under the different seismic level, the building structural performance level is also divided into four run phases of structure. Taking reinforced concrete frame (RC frame) as the research structure, through statistical analysis of a large number of domestic and foreign tests of RC frame, story drift angle limits of the RC frame structure in four run phases are quantified. Subsequently, by taking the six-story and eight-story three-dimensional RC frames as examples, elastic-plastic analysis using software SAP2000 is conducted on the examples. Two natural waves and an artificial wave are selected to load separately on two RC frames, and then the story drift angle limits of RC frame can be obtained. From the result of simulation analysis, the story drift angle limits of the statistical analysis seem to be reasonable.
